Onboarding note for the Ledgerpane admin table: bulk edits are applied through the batcher service, not directly against the database. Select rows, choose an action, and the batcher stages changes in a pending set you can review before commit. Edits over 500 rows require a second approver — this is enforced server-side, so don't try to chunk around it. To run the batcher locally you need the staging write credential, which goes in your .env as the next line.

secret setting of bahip-kagag: RELAY_SECRET3=c83

☐ Snapshot tests for the Lanternkit UI components — yes, even during the key ceremony. Before rotating anything, run the full snapshot suite on the Ombra staging box and eyeball any diffs; stale snapshots have bitten future-us twice already. If diffs are intentional, regenerate and commit in the same change. The snapshot baseline archive is sealed along with the ceremony materials, so you'll need to unlock it before regenerating anything. The recovery passphrase for that archive appears directly below.

vault phrase of tajop-haduf = holath-brivan-wenax

Facilities Ticket — Shared Lab Access, Fennick Wing

Contractors: the Tidemark Lab on Level 2 is shared with the Orrery team this week. Ducting work is approved for Tuesday–Thursday, 08:00–16:00 only. Keep the partition curtain closed; their optics bench is dust-sensitive. Tools stay on the trolley, not the benches. Sign in at the wing desk each morning. Enter via the side door using the code below.

door code, yagap-bahof: bdg-O-05

## Runbook: Websocket Compression Tradeoffs

For the sync: we've been flip-flopping on permessage-deflate for the Lanternfeed socket gateway. Short version — compression saves ~40% bandwidth on chatty dashboards but eats CPU on the edge nodes, and context takeover makes memory spiky under reconnect storms. Current call: enable it only for payloads over 1KB, no context takeover. To toggle the flag via the internal config service, authenticate with the key below.

gateway credential: kto3_qfe